Standing Building Recording (November 2005 - December 2006)

NT 0038 7708 A programme of archaeological works and historic building recording was undertaken at Hame's Best, St Michael's Wynd, between November 2005 and December 2006 to satisfy a planning condition. The site was occupied by a mid- to late 18th-century stone building (Hame's Best), which will be retained in the development, and back garden to the rear. A RCHME Level 2 building recording was undertaken at the former two-storey stone building. In addition, a programme of archaeological works was carried out consisting of the exposing, recording and partial excavation of a domestic stone cistern within, and contemporary with, the building. In addition, archaeological monitoring was undertaken on the excavation of service trenches within the building and the removal of the W wall, the S gable and the roof. A year later further excavations for a new garage were monitored toward the S end of the same plot. This latter area had been landscaped during the creation of an adjacent railway line in the 19th century

Archive to be deposited in NMRS. Report lodged with WoSAS SMR and NMRS.
